Baseball Recap: Raytown Bluejays vs. Van Horn Falcons
After having lost a blowout in their previous game against Platte County, Raytown was happy to have turned things around on Thursday.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the Van Horn Falcons, sneaking past 8-6. The win was a breath of fresh air for the Bluejays as it put an end to their four-game losing streak.
Raytown's victory bumped their record up to 4-17. As for Van Horn, they have been struggling recently as they've lost seven of their last eight cont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 11-16 record this season.
Raytown w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next match, a 17-2 defeat against Fort Osage on the 16th. As for Van Horn, they will challenge Platte County at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day. The Pirates' pitching crew has only allowed 3.7 runs per game this season, so the Falcons' hitters will have their work cut out for them.
